Pearl Harbor hero Hatfield Rosengren returns home on furlough
Hatfield Rosengren, hailed as a Pearl Harbor hero, is welcomed home on a short furlough. He was in Seattle where his ship the California underwent repairs after sustaining serious damage. Known as Hart during his days at Teton High, he was initially reported missing in action but later found alive.

Former Choteau Lady Taken in Iowa
Word reached Choteau that Mrs. Jess Keithley died at her Springville Iowa home. The Keithleys were homesteaders west of Choteau during the land boom and she once worked on The Acantha staff in 1912 and 1914, leaving the town over two decades ago.

High School Transportation Funds Distributed by County Supt
County Supt Muriel Reiquam distributed 8,382.96 in high school transportation funds for June to December to Teton County H S 2830.93 H S Dist 21 2799.21 H S Dist 30 1742.28 H S Dist 28 559.14 and out of county transfers 450.16. Accredited high school funds totaling 44,996.40 were also distributed with Teton H S 15144.83 H S Dist 21 15220.03 H S Dist 30 7408.76 H D Dist 28 6457.78 and out of county transfers 765.

Mary Ellen Meadows Weds Leslie C Burns at Cho teau Home Ceremony
Mary Ellen Meadows and Leslie C Burns were married at a Christmas day ceremony in the bride's grandmother's home in Choteau. Rev. Bert A Powell officiated as family and close friends attended. The bride, a Buffalo teacher and Montana State College alumna, wore a gold wool dress. The groom, nicknamed Judge, is the son of former mayor C W Burns and works with engineers on the Great Falls air base project. They began a brief wedding trip before she resumed teaching and he his air base duties.
